What Are Financial Recovery Technologies?

Financial recovery technologies are software tools and digital systems designed to help businesses recover from financial losses, data breaches, failed transactions, and cyberattacks. These technologies protect sensitive financial information and ensure that companies can continue operating after technical disruptions.

Financial recovery systems are commonly used in:

  • Online banking
  • Fintech companies
  • Insurance organizations
  • Investment firms
  • E-commerce businesses
  • Cryptocurrency exchanges

Modern recovery systems use Artificial Intelligence (AI), blockchain, cloud computing, machine learning, and cybersecurity technologies to improve financial protection and recovery speed.

Role of Software Engineers in Financial Recovery Technologies

Software engineers are responsible for designing, building, and maintaining financial recovery systems. Their work helps financial companies protect customer data and maintain secure digital services.

Developing Secure Financial Applications

Software engineers create secure applications used by banks and financial companies. These systems must safely process large numbers of transactions while protecting sensitive information.

Engineers focus on:

  • Secure coding practices
  • Encrypted data storage
  • API security
  • Authentication systems
  • Financial transaction monitoring

Security is one of the top priorities in financial software development.

Building Fraud Detection Systems

Fraud detection is a major part of financial recovery technology. Software engineers use AI and machine learning to create systems that identify suspicious financial activity in real time.

Fraud detection software can:

  • Monitor transaction patterns
  • Detect unusual spending behavior
  • Block unauthorized payments
  • Alert security teams immediately

These systems help financial companies reduce financial losses caused by fraud.

Managing Disaster Recovery Solutions

Financial systems must remain operational at all times. Software engineers build disaster recovery systems that restore financial operations after technical failures or cyberattacks.

Disaster recovery technologies include:

  • Cloud backups
  • Automated server recovery
  • Database restoration systems
  • Real-time data replication

These solutions help companies recover quickly and avoid long service interruptions.

Salary Expectations for Software Engineers in the USA

Software engineers specializing in financial recovery technologies often earn competitive salaries.

Estimated salary ranges in 2026 include:

  • Entry-Level Software Engineer: $80,000–$110,000
  • Mid-Level Engineer: $120,000–$160,000
  • Senior Recovery Engineer: $180,000+
  • Cybersecurity Specialist: $150,000+

Salaries depend on experience, certifications, and technical expertise.
